In the first Saturday race of the 2012 NASCAR Sprint Cup Series, the Texas Motor Speedway played host to the Samsung Mobile 500.
The race was largely uneventful, but points leader Greg Biffle managed to win his first race of the season to extend his lead in the chase for the Sprint Cup. Indeed, it was the first checkered flag that Biffle had won since October of 2010. Biffle had previously clung to the top spot on the Sprint Cup leaderboard thanks to top-10 finishes in four of the first six races of the season, including starting off 2012 with three straight third-place finishes.
Biffle took the lead on Lap 304 of 334 and hung on for the win, his second at Texas Motor Speedway. He now holds a 19-point lead over second-place Matt Kenseth and Dale Earnhardt, Jr., who finished in fifth place and 10th place, respectively.
